加入收藏 | 设为首页 | 会员中心 | 我要投稿 91站长网 (https://www.91zhanzhang.com/)- 机器学习、操作系统、大数据、低代码、数据湖!
当前位置: 首页 > 运营中心 > 搜索优化 > 正文

漏洞修复联合索引重构双引擎提速搜索

发布时间:2026-03-16 10:11:19 所属栏目:搜索优化 来源:DaWei
导读:  在数字化浪潮中,搜索功能已成为各类应用与系统的核心组件,其性能直接影响用户体验与业务效率。然而,随着数据量的指数级增长和用户需求的多样化,传统搜索架构逐渐暴露出响应延迟、资源占用高等问题。某大型电

  在数字化浪潮中,搜索功能已成为各类应用与系统的核心组件,其性能直接影响用户体验与业务效率。然而,随着数据量的指数级增长和用户需求的多样化,传统搜索架构逐渐暴露出响应延迟、资源占用高等问题。某大型电商平台曾因搜索延迟导致用户流失率上升15%,这一案例揭示了搜索性能优化的紧迫性。近期,一种结合漏洞修复与联合索引重构的“双引擎”技术方案引发行业关注,其通过系统化优化实现搜索效率的质的飞跃,为高并发场景下的性能瓶颈提供了创新解法。


  漏洞修复是搜索优化的基础工程。传统搜索系统因代码冗余、权限管理疏漏等问题,易成为黑客攻击的突破口。例如,未过滤的特殊字符输入可能导致SQL注入攻击,进而拖慢数据库响应甚至引发服务崩溃;而索引文件权限配置不当,可能被恶意篡改导致搜索结果异常。某金融平台曾因搜索接口存在越权漏洞,导致用户隐私数据泄露,同时搜索服务因频繁异常重启,平均响应时间增加300毫秒。通过引入自动化漏洞扫描工具与人工代码审计相结合的方式,团队修复了包括输入验证缺失、权限控制粒度不足等23类高危漏洞,并建立动态防护机制,使系统抗攻击能力提升80%,为后续性能优化扫清障碍。


AI模拟效果图,仅供参考

  联合索引重构则是提升搜索速度的核心引擎。传统单字段索引在多条件查询时需多次遍历数据表,而联合索引通过将多个字段合并构建树形结构,可将复杂查询转化为单次索引扫描。以电商商品搜索为例,用户常同时使用“品牌+价格区间+关键词”进行筛选,若为每个字段单独建索引,系统需执行3次磁盘I/O操作;而构建(品牌,价格,关键词)联合索引后,仅需1次操作即可定位目标数据。某物流企业通过重构订单查询系统的索引策略,将平均查询时间从2.3秒降至0.4秒,吞吐量提升4倍。更关键的是,联合索引需根据业务场景动态调整字段顺序——高频查询条件应置于索引前列,低频条件靠后,以最大化索引命中率。


  “双引擎”的协同效应体现在漏洞修复与索引重构的互补性上。漏洞修复消除系统安全隐患,避免因安全事件导致的性能波动;联合索引重构则从底层架构优化数据访问路径,减少不必要的计算资源消耗。某在线教育平台在实施双引擎方案后,搜索服务可用性从99.2%提升至99.95%,日均错误率下降76%,同时CPU占用率降低40%。这种优化不仅直接改善用户体验,更间接降低了运维成本——据测算,该平台每年可节省因性能问题导致的用户流失损失超200万元,服务器扩容费用减少35%。


  技术落地的关键在于精细化实施。漏洞修复需建立常态化扫描机制,结合DevSecOps流程将安全检查嵌入开发闭环;联合索引重构则需基于查询日志分析,通过A/B测试验证不同索引组合的效果。某社交平台通过分析用户搜索行为数据,发现“地理位置+兴趣标签”的查询占比达62%,据此重构索引后,相关查询响应速度提升5倍。双引擎方案需与缓存策略、异步处理等技术结合,形成多层次优化体系。例如,将热门搜索结果缓存至内存,可减少80%的数据库访问;而异步处理非实时查询请求,则可避免瞬时高并发对系统的冲击。


  从漏洞修复到索引重构,双引擎方案为搜索性能优化提供了可复制的实践路径。它证明,技术升级不应局限于单一维度,而需通过系统化思维实现安全与效率的双重提升。随着AI搜索、实时分析等新需求的涌现,这种“防御+加速”的组合策略或将成为搜索架构演进的标配,助力企业在数据驱动的时代抢占先机。

(编辑:91站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章